Definition of Khn

Al-Kāhin is the soothsayer who claims to know the unseen.

The Almighty says: 'And it is not the word of a soothsayer' (Al-Haqqah 42).

Al-kahānah is forbidden divination.

The Prophet was neither poet nor soothsayer.

Surah At-Tur : 29 Meccan
﴿فَذَكِّرْ فَمَآ أَنتَ بِنِعْمَتِ رَبِّكَ بِكَاهِنٍ وَلَا مَجْنُونٍ
So remind [O Muhammad], for you are not, by the favor of your Lord, a soothsayer or a madman.
Surah Al-Haqqa : 42 Meccan
﴿وَلَا بِقَوْلِ كَاهِنٍ قَلِيلًا مَّا تَذَكَّرُونَ
Nor the word of a soothsayer; little do you remember.
